How to Plant Aquarium Plants in Gravel. To plant aquarium plants in gravel, layer your tank's gravel about three inches above the aquarium floor. Add some fertilizer to the gravel. Fill the aquarium about half full of water. Then carefully place the plants in the gravel. Then cover with the substrate making sure it is above root level.

They do so by redirecting the incoming flow and increasing the settling surface area. A series of plates or tubes are installed at a 60-degree angle to the tank's surface. As water enters the system, it is slowed down and redirected to flow up between the plates. The redirected flow provides an improved equal-flow pattern.

Pea gravel vs river rock is simply a difference in size. Pea gravel is composed of small river rocks that average around 3/8 inch in size. When it comes to drainage, pea gravel works great when water will be flowing straight down or if it has a gravel grid underneath to keep it in place.
Rapid sand filtration is a physical process that removes suspended solids from the water. Rapid sand filtration is much more common than flow sand filtration, because rapid sand filters have fairly high flow rates and require relatively little space to operate.
